首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

OpenCV退出代码-1073741819 (0xC0000005)

OpenCV退出代码-1073741819 (0xC0000005)是一个常见的错误代码,表示程序在执行过程中遇到了访问冲突或内存错误。这个错误通常与指针操作、内存泄漏或无效的内存引用有关。

OpenCV是一个开源的计算机视觉库,提供了丰富的图像和视频处理功能。它被广泛应用于图像处理、计算机视觉、机器学习等领域。

当出现OpenCV退出代码-1073741819时,可能是由以下原因引起的:

  1. 内存错误:程序可能尝试访问无效的内存地址或释放了已释放的内存。这可能是由于指针操作错误、内存泄漏或内存越界引起的。
  2. 编译器错误:某些编译器可能存在错误,导致程序在执行过程中出现问题。可以尝试更新编译器版本或使用其他编译器。
  3. OpenCV版本不兼容:某些OpenCV版本可能存在bug或与其他库不兼容,导致程序崩溃。可以尝试更新OpenCV版本或查看是否存在已知的问题和解决方案。

针对这个错误,可以采取以下措施进行排查和解决:

  1. 检查代码:仔细检查代码中是否存在指针操作错误、内存泄漏或无效的内存引用。确保所有的内存操作都是正确的,并避免访问已释放的内存。
  2. 调试程序:使用调试工具对程序进行调试,查看在出现错误之前的代码执行情况。可以通过设置断点、观察变量值等方式来定位问题所在。
  3. 更新OpenCV版本:如果使用的是较旧的OpenCV版本,尝试更新到最新版本,以获得更好的稳定性和兼容性。
  4. 检查依赖库:确保所使用的其他库与OpenCV兼容,并且没有冲突或版本不匹配的情况。
  5. 咨询社区:如果以上方法无法解决问题,可以向OpenCV社区或相关论坛提问,寻求其他开发者的帮助和建议。

腾讯云提供了一系列与计算机视觉相关的产品和服务,例如腾讯云图像处理、腾讯云人脸识别、腾讯云智能视频分析等。您可以访问腾讯云官方网站了解更多关于这些产品的详细信息和使用指南。

腾讯云图像处理产品介绍:https://cloud.tencent.com/product/ivp

腾讯云人脸识别产品介绍:https://cloud.tencent.com/product/fr

腾讯云智能视频分析产品介绍:https://cloud.tencent.com/product/vca

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券